Refresh the Kitchen for a Healthier Lifestyle
If your goal is to eat healthier and cook more fresh meals at home, a tired and cramped kitchen might not be the best environment for you. If you want to stick to the plan, a kitchen redesign can introduce smarter layouts, better storage, and upgraded smart appliances.
Whether you need more worktop space, a breakfast bar for the family, or a full open-plan spacious kitchen for entertainment, now is the perfect time to plan it. Next year’s goal will be much easier to maintain.
Create a Bathroom That Supports Self-Care and Wellness
A new bathroom is more than just a place to batter through a tiring morning routine. With modern tiles, contemporary fixtures, superior water systems, and the perfect lighting, you can build yourself a calming retreat. And it’s not just about creating a spa.
Homes with older bathrooms can enjoy improved safety and energy efficiency too. Or, if you are finding yourself less mobile, that bathroom could be converted into an accessible wet room to support you or an elderly relative.
Unlock New Living Space with a Cellar Conversion
Many homes in the Northamptonshire area have unused basements that become storage zones for old tools, holiday decorations, and archaic clutter. Converting your cellar is one of the best way to increase your living space without having to extend your home.
If you’re dreaming of a home cinema, gym, office, games room, or even an extra bedroom, a well-planned conversion will utterly reshape your home. Could that extra space improve your lifestyle and help you with your resolution goals?
Transform the Garage into a Space with Purpose
If your garage is better known for its cobwebs and rusty tools than for housing a car, you might be better served with a garage conversion. You could create a bright new office, a playroom, utility area, or even an extra bedroom. With so many people working remote or hybrid contracts, additional living space is more valuable than ever.
Make Your Home More Energy Efficient
Improving loft insulation, investing in new flooring, upgrading your lighting, or installing more efficient fixtures will help reduce your cost in 2026. If you’re planning a renovation, it is a good time to talk to your builders and plan energy-saving improvements.
